Key Responsibilities

  • •Own compute fleet health end to end. Build the metrics pipelines, alerting, and unified health view that tell you the true state of every GPU and TPU in production — across Kubernetes-orchestrated workloads and bare metal, at scale.
  • •Turn repair into a pipeline, not a procedure. Build and own the automation that takes a compute failure from detection through triage, parts management, and return to service. No one-off scripts, no heroics.
  • •Design and expand the XPU qualification platform. Burn-in, performance baselining, and NPI execution for every new GPU and TPU generation. You define what "good" looks like before hardware goes into production.
  • •Own Redfish and BMC tooling. Firmware-level telemetry, log collection at fleet scale, and the low-level access layer that repair automation and health tooling depend on.
  • •Own end-to-end reliability, scalability, and operation of the compute fleet at-scale. Fluidstack is building one of the largest XPU fleets in the world and that can only be accomplished with aggressive automation, tooling, and incident discipline.

Key Requirements

  • •Shipped production automation or tooling at scale in a hardware/software environment
  • •Experience designing or operating compute infrastructure (GPU/TPU, Kubernetes, bare metal)
  • •Proficiency with telemetry, metrics, and incident response tooling (e.g., Redfish, BMC, Prometheus, Grafana)
  • •Ability to own complex end-to-end systems and drive projects with minimal supervision
  • •Comfort with ambiguity, rapid iteration, and working across hardware and software teams
